Default directory with database is /etc/corosync/qnetd. This directory has to be writable by current user. QNetd CA certificate is also exported into file /etc/corosync/qnetd/nssdb/qnetd-cacert.crt. .TP .B -s Sign cluster certificate. It's required to pass name of cluster (equal to one configured in corosync.conf) and certificate request file. Signed certificate is stored into file /etc/corosync/qnetd/nssdb/cluster-$ClusterName.crt .TP .B -c Certificate request file to sign. .TP .B -n Name of the cluster. .SH NOTES If qnetd is executed by non root user, /etc/corosync/qnetd and it's subdirectories has to have set owner (and/or group) to given user. If .B corosync-qnetd-certutil is executed as root it tries to copy owner and group of /etc/corosync/qnetd to all its created files. .SH SEE ALSO .BR corosync-qnetd (8) .BR corosync-qdevice (8) .SH AUTHOR Jan Friesse .PP
